Find m∠NAB
a) 55
b) 110
c) 80
d) 95

Answer:
95
Step-by-step explanation:
The exterior angle is the sum of the opposite interior angles
8x+7 = 5x+40
Subtract 5x from each side
8x+7-5x = 5x+40-5x
3x+7 = 40
Subtract 7 from each side
3x+7-7 = 40-7
3x=33
Divide by 3
3x/3 = 33/3
x = 11
Find <NAB
<NAB = 8x+7 = 8*11+7 = 88+7 = 95
